Carey solves the equation 4 (2 x minus 1) + 5 = 3 + 2 (x + 1) by applying the distributive property on both sides of the equation. The result is 8 x minus 4 + 5 = 3 + 2 x + 2. Carey then wants to combine like terms. Which are the terms Carey should combine?

8x + 2x
–4 + 5 + 3 + 2
–4 + 5 and 3 + 2
4 + 5 and 3 + 2

Let's look at the equation Carey has after applying the distributive property:

\[ 8x - 4 + 5 = 3 + 2x + 2 \]

Now, we need to identify which terms can be combined on both sides of the equation.

On the left side:

  • The terms are \(8x\) and \(-4 + 5\).

On the right side:

  • The terms are \(2x\) and \(3 + 2\).

So the terms that Carey should combine are:

  • On the left side, \(-4 + 5\) can be combined.
  • On the right side, \(3 + 2\) can be combined.

Thus, the correct answer is: –4 + 5 and 3 + 2.
